Oven not heating

Heating trouble can involve bake elements, broil elements, igniters, sensors, relays, or control boards.

Door, controls, and self-clean

Door hardware and electronic controls should be diagnosed without forcing stuck locks or bypassing safety systems.

What The Technician May Need To Evaluate

Heating and ignition problems require the correct distinction between power or gas supply, the heating system, sensors, controls, and door-related conditions. The main symptom groups on this page include wall ovens and cooktops, oven not heating, and door, controls, and self-clean. Testing helps confirm which system is actually responsible before parts are replaced.

Should I keep using the appliance before service?+

Only continue using the appliance if it appears safe. Stop use for sparks, smoke, gas odor, a burning electrical smell, active leaking near electrical parts, unusual overheating, or repeated breaker trips, and arrange professional service.
